فارو 10 جو رليز، سمال ٽاڪ ٻوليءَ جي هڪ ٻولي

فارو 10 پروجيڪٽ جو هڪ رليز، جيڪو Smalltalk پروگرامنگ ٻولي جي ٻولي کي ترقي ڪري ٿو، مهيا ڪيو ويو آهي. فارو اسڪوڪ پروجيڪٽ جو هڪ شاخ آهي، جيڪو ايلن ڪي، اسمال ٽالڪ جي ليکڪ پاران ٺاهيل هو. پروگرامنگ ٻولي کي لاڳو ڪرڻ کان علاوه، فارو ڪوڊ ايگزيڪيوٽو ڪرڻ لاءِ هڪ ورچوئل مشين پڻ فراهم ڪري ٿو، هڪ مربوط ترقياتي ماحول، هڪ ڊيبگر، ۽ لائبريرين جو هڪ سيٽ، بشمول GUI ڊولپمينٽ لاءِ لائبريريون. پروجيڪٽ ڪوڊ MIT لائسنس تحت ورهايو ويو آهي.

نئين رليز ۾ تبديلين مان، ڪوڊ صاف ڪرڻ بيٺو آهي - پراڻو ڪوڊ هٽايو ويو آهي (Glamour، GTTools، Spec1، اڻڄاتل بائيٽ ڪوڊ لاءِ سپورٽ) ۽ افاديت جيڪي ختم ٿيل ڪوڊ تي ڀاڙين ٿيون انهن کي ٻيهر لکيو ويو آهي (انحصار تجزيي ڪندڙ، تنقيدي برائوزر، وغيره) . تبديليون ڪيون ويون آھن پروجيڪٽ جي ماڊليت کي وڌائڻ ۽ گھٽ ۾ گھٽ سائز جون تصويرون پيدا ڪرڻ جي صلاحيت. ڪارڪردگي بهتر ڪرڻ ۽ تصويرن جي سائيز کي گهٽائڻ لاءِ ڪم ڪيو ويو آهي (بيس تصوير جي سائيز 66 کان 58 ايم بي تائين گھٽجي وئي آهي). VM بهتر ڪيو آهي ڪوڊ سان لاڳاپيل مطابقت رکندڙ I/O، ساکٽ هينڊلنگ، ۽ FFI ABI.

جو ذريعو: opennet.ru

تبصرو شامل ڪريو